Hardware Differences Shape File Choices
Every device has its own limits for storage and playback performance. A file working smoothly on a powerful computer may place greater demands on older equipment. Selecting suitable formats can reduce unnecessary conversion while supporting reliable viewing.
Portable hardware also requires attention to battery use and available memory. Moderate settings can often provide suitable clarity without demanding excessive resources.

Format Support Varies Across Devices
Not every file type works equally well across phones and computers. Common formats usually provide broader compatibility while reducing the need for extra conversion. Checking supported types beforehand helps avoid playback problems after content has been stored.
Operating systems may also handle certain media formats differently. Choosing widely supported options can simplify transfers between separate pieces of equipment.

Screen Dimensions Influence Resolution Needs
Compact displays may show moderate picture settings clearly during normal playback. Very high resolution can consume additional memory without producing an obvious improvement on smaller screens. Larger monitors can reveal finer details more easily when suitable source quality exists.
Viewing distance can change these differences further. Users sitting farther from a display may notice fewer improvements from extremely high settings.
